A sheet of glass is coated with a 495-nm-thick layer of oil (n = 1.42).
1- what visible wavelengths of light do the reflected waves interfere constructively?
2- what visible wavelengths of light do the reflected waves interfere destructively?
3- What is the color of reflected light? ( Yellow, Green-blue, Red, or Orange)
4- What is the color of the most part of transmitted light? ( Orange, Redm, Blue, or Yellowish green)
